The ROHM MCR03EZPFX1003 is a 0603 thick film surface mount resistor rated at 100 kΩ with ±1% tolerance and 0.1 W power rating. Key Features

  • 100 kΩ resistance at ±1% tolerance in a compact 0603 (1.6 mm × 0.8 mm) package for precise circuit performance
  • Low ±100 ppm/°C temperature coefficient ensures stable resistance across wide temperature ranges in precision applications
  • 0.1 W rated thick film SMD resistor with RoHS and REACH compliance for modern eco-conscious designs
  • 0603 SMT package with 0.45 mm height supports dense automated PCB assembly with standard pick-and-place equipment

Applications

The MCR03EZPFX1003 is widely used in voltage divider networks, pull-up/pull-down circuits, and current-limiting resistor applications in consumer electronics, industrial sensors, and telecommunications equipment. Its ±1% tolerance and ±100 ppm/°C coefficient make it suitable for precision analog signal conditioning circuits in medical instrumentation and data acquisition systems. The compact 0603 form factor fits high-density PCB designs in IoT devices, wearables, and embedded computing modules requiring accurate 100 kΩ resistance values.

Frequently Asked Questions

What is the resistance value, tolerance, and temperature coefficient of the MCR03EZPFX1003?

The MCR03EZPFX1003 has a resistance value of 100 kΩ with a ±1% tolerance and a temperature coefficient of ±100 ppm/°C. This combination ensures the resistance stays within ±1% of 100 kΩ at 25°C and drifts no more than ±100 ppm per degree Celsius over the operating temperature range, suitable for precision voltage divider and biasing circuits.

How does the 0603 package size of the MCR03EZPFX1003 affect PCB layout and assembly?

The 0603 package measures 1.6 mm in length, 0.8 mm in width, and 0.45 mm in height, making it one of the more common SMT sizes compatible with standard pick-and-place equipment. Its compact footprint allows high-density placement on PCBs with 0.5 mm pitch pad layouts, and the 0.1 W power rating is adequate for signal-level applications in most embedded and consumer electronics designs.

Is the MCR03EZPFX1003 suitable for medical or industrial applications requiring strict compliance?

Yes, the MCR03EZPFX1003 is RoHS Pb-free compliant and REACH compliant per its JESD-609 Code e3 designation, satisfying regulatory requirements for medical devices, industrial equipment, and products sold in the EU. The ±1% tolerance and ±100 ppm/°C temperature coefficient also meet precision requirements for sensor signal conditioning in medical instrumentation.

What power dissipation limit should be observed when using the MCR03EZPFX1003 in a 5 V circuit?

The MCR03EZPFX1003 is rated at 0.1 W maximum power dissipation. In a 5 V circuit, the maximum continuous current through a 100 kΩ resistor is 50 µA, dissipating 0.25 mW — well within the 0.1 W rating. For a 50 V supply, dissipation would be 25 mW, still safe. Exceeding 0.1 W risks permanent resistance shift or open-circuit failure.
